About
I am an international entertainment and IP attorney based between Lagos and New York. As Associate Attorney at The Law Offices of Robert A. Celestin, I represent global artists navigating the business of music across Africa, the U.S., and beyond.
My roster includes BNXN fka Buju, Seyi Vibez, Vector, Sabri, and Shaboozey. My work spans contract negotiation, publishing strategy, catalog protection, and cross-border deal structuring. Named to Billboard's Top Music Lawyers list three consecutive years — 2023, 2024, and 2025.
My mission is simple: make sure international artists don't just go viral — they stay protected. I translate complex IP and deal structures into strategies that creatives can understand, apply, and build with.
